WildFly: Server Aplikasi Kuat untuk Pengembangan Java di Lingkungan Linux

wildflylogo

WildFly, sebelumnya dikenal dengan nama JBoss, adalah server aplikasi yang kuat dan canggih yang memungkinkan pengembang Java untuk mengembangkan, menguji, dan menjalankan aplikasi Java Enterprise Edition (Java EE) dengan efisien. Artikel ini akan membahas tentang WildFly Server, mengapa ia menjadi pilihan populer di dunia pengembangan Java, serta langkah-langkah awal untuk memulai penggunaannya di lingkungan Linux.

Keunggulan WildFly Server:

  1. Penerapan Spesifikasi Java EE: WildFly merupakan server aplikasi yang sepenuhnya mendukung spesifikasi Java EE. Ini memungkinkan pengembang untuk mengembangkan aplikasi dengan menggunakan berbagai komponen standar Java EE seperti Servlets, JSP, EJB, JPA, dan banyak lagi.
  2. Pengelolaan Aplikasi yang Kuat: WildFly menyediakan antarmuka manajemen web yang canggih untuk mengelola aplikasi secara terpusat. Ini memungkinkan pengguna untuk mendeploy, mengunduh, dan mengelola aplikasi dengan mudah tanpa harus menghentikan server.
  3. Skalabilitas dan Failover: WildFly memiliki dukungan untuk clustering dan failover, memungkinkan aplikasi Anda untuk mencapai skalabilitas horizontal dan ketersediaan tinggi.
  4. Konfigurasi yang Fleksibel: WildFly memiliki sistem konfigurasi yang fleksibel yang memungkinkan pengguna untuk menyesuaikan berbagai pengaturan server sesuai kebutuhan aplikasi.
  5. Dukungan Teknologi Terbaru: WildFly terus berkembang dan mendukung teknologi terbaru seperti Jakarta EE (lanjutan dari Java EE) dan MicroProfile untuk pengembangan aplikasi berbasis mikroservis.

Memulai dengan WildFly di Linux:

  1. Unduh dan Ekstrak WildFly: Kunjungi situs resmi WildFly untuk mengunduh distribusi WildFly. Setelah unduhan selesai, ekstrak arsip ke direktori yang diinginkan.
  2. Memulai Server: Buka terminal dan navigasi ke direktori tempat Anda meng-ekstrak WildFly. Gunakan perintah berikut untuk memulai server:
bash
cd /path/to/wildfly_directory/bin ./standalone.sh

Ini akan memulai server standalone WildFly.

  1. Mengakses Antarmuka Manajemen: Buka browser dan akses antarmuka manajemen WildFly melalui URL http://localhost:9990. Anda akan diminta untuk masuk menggunakan kredensial yang telah Anda tentukan.
  2. Mengelola Aplikasi: Melalui antarmuka manajemen, Anda dapat mendeploy aplikasi Java EE atau Jakarta EE. Anda juga dapat mengatur sumber daya, pengaturan server, dan banyak lagi.
  3. Menghentikan Server: Untuk menghentikan server WildFly, kembali ke terminal di mana Anda menjalankan server dan tekan Ctrl+C.

Kesimpulan: WildFly Server adalah pilihan kuat untuk pengembangan dan penerapan aplikasi Java EE di lingkungan Linux. Dengan dukungan penuh terhadap spesifikasi Java EE dan Jakarta EE, serta kemampuannya dalam pengelolaan aplikasi, skalabilitas, dan dukungan teknologi terbaru, WildFly menjadi pilihan populer di kalangan pengembang Java. Dengan mengikuti panduan instalasi dan penggunaan sederhana di atas, Anda dapat memulai penggunaan WildFly untuk mengembangkan aplikasi yang andal dan berkinerja tinggi.


0 Komentar:

Posting Komentar